St. Katharine Drexel Preparatory School is proud to announce the start of a transformative three-month roof renovation project beginning next week. This $1.2 million investment marks a major milestone in the school’s ongoing commitment to preserving and enhancing its historic campus for future generations.
Phase one will begin with the gymnasium and Convent, areas chosen to minimize disruption to students during the school day, followed by upgrades to the Drexel Center. The final phase will take place over the Thanksgiving and Christmas breaks, completing the main building to ensure a fully restored and structurally sound facility.
“This project represents a critical step in protecting the structural integrity of the campus and preparing Drexel Prep for the next century of excellence,” said Keith Doley, one of the five alumni owners, 5116 Magazine Corporation. “By investing in our facilities today, we’re ensuring the mission of Saint Katharine Drexel continues, empowering students to learn, lead, and thrive for generations to come.”
